How does Section 8 work in Lone Tree?

Section 8 is a program in Lone Tree that helps people with low incomes afford housing. Participants in the program pay between 30 and 40% of their monthly income for housing costs. The housing provided through Section 8 must meet federal standards to ensure it is safe and decent for everyone involved.

Do I qualify for Section 8 in Lone Tree?

To determine if you qualify for Section 8 in Lone Tree, you should check the income limits for your specific area. These limits typically range from 30% to 80% of the median income for the region. You can find this information on the HUD website or by reaching out to your local housing authority.
